Problems solved by technology

The advantage of short TTI is to shorten the transmission delay, but the corresponding cost is high control signaling overhead and low spectrum efficiency
For a terminal with multiple types of services at the same time, if a unified TTI is determined based on the service requiring the minimum delay, resources will be wasted
In addition, on the carrier that supports short TTI transmission, the compatibility with the existing LTE system cannot be guaranteed, that is, it cannot be compatible with 1ms TTI

Abstract

Provided is a data transmission method, comprising: a terminal device receiving first downlink control information (DCI), the first DCI being used for scheduling a first physical downlink shared channel (PDSCH) transmitted using a first transmission time interval (TTI); if the terminal device receives a second DCI within the time period of receiving the first PDSCH, the terminal device receives the second DCI, the second DCI is used for scheduling a second PDSCH transmitted by using a second TTI, and the first TTI is greater than the second TTI; wherein the terminal device does not demodulatethe first PDSCH. According to the method provided by the embodiment of the invention, a plurality of TTIs can be dynamically supported in the same carrier to perform data transmission, the terminal equipment can determine the priority of the transmission channel in one carrier, and the method not only can meet the requirement of time delay, but also can consider the compatibility with the existingsystem.
